Boy, 13, Critically Injured In South Austin Shooting
(STMW) -- A 13-year-old boy was critically wounded Friday evening in a South Austin neighborhood shooting on the West Side.
Two groups of people got into a "heated" argument at 8:27 p.m. in the 5500 block of West Jackson when a male pulled out a gun and fired shots, according to Chicago Police. The boy, who was standing down the street, was hit by a stray bullet in the lower back.
He was taken to Mount Sinai Hospital in critical condition, police said.
